Analysis

In 2018, dominican republic —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int in Indonesia stood at 10,634 1000 USD. That is the highest value across all 15 years on record.

The figure is up 69.9% on the previous year and up 1,011.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, dominican republic —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int in Indonesia peaked at 10,634 1000 USD in 2018 and was at its lowest, 18 1000 USD, in 2003.

That places Indonesia 3rd out of 46 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
